Output 10852387e438c0e265e6aa24e5a870f490a25628a80343a3a7fa77c4755b6725:0

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890e2969179aee8a7f8ba7553a99c8608cbadd68 OP_EQUAL
address
3EBhToQJ38G3VWvVcavNsCoE6jjvtEj9rT
transaction
10852387e438c0e265e6aa24e5a870f490a25628a80343a3a7fa77c4755b6725
spent
true